John G. Ullman & Associates's Q3 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2016, John G. Ullman & Associates held 125 positions worth $486M, down 0.15% from $487M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 34% of the portfolio.

John G. Ullman & Associates withdrew a net $16.7M in Q3 2016, closing 9 positions and reducing 71 holdings. Its most notable exit was EMC CORPORATION, an estimated $4.68M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 26% of assets, down from 28%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Technology.

Against the trend, John G. Ullman & Associates opened a new position in ConocoPhillips worth $5.62M.
